Even Further West: Unveiling the Poetry of Eric Paul Shaffer

When it comes to contemporary American poets, Eric Paul Shaffer stands out as a true wordsmith who invites readers on a captivating journey. With his extraordinary collection titled "Even Further West," Shaffer transcends boundaries both geographically and intellectually, weaving together vivid imagery, profound emotions, and thought-provoking themes that leave a lasting impact on the reader's mind.
From the moment you open the book, you're transported to the western frontiers of America, embarking on a poetic expedition like no other. Shaffer's poetic voice echoes through the pages, offering a rich tapestry of experiences, cultural reflections, and personal introspections that paint a vibrant picture of the wild landscapes stretching far and wide.
The Beauty of Shaffer's Pen
Shaffer's poetry possesses an astounding ability to capture the essence of the West in its truest form. His words, like brushstrokes on a canvas, bring to life the majestic mountains, deep canyons, and endless plains that form the Western United States. By interweaving nature into his verses, Shaffer not only creates visuals but also evokes emotions, making the reader feel the scorching sun, the cool breeze, and the scent of wildflowers.

What makes Shaffer's work even more exceptional is his keen observation and understanding of the people who inhabit these landscapes. Through his poems, he leads us to meet cowboys and lone travelers, natives and pioneers, each with their own stories and dreams. As we delve deeper into Shaffer's world, we begin to uncover the layers of complexities that bind humans to their terrains, crafting an exquisite tapestry of varied cultures and shared experiences.
Shaffer's language is a marvel in itself. His mastery of metaphor, similes, and descriptive language creates a vivid imagery that is second to none. Reading his poems feels like walking through a gallery of art, each word carefully chosen to paint a vivid landscape or delve into the innermost depths of the human soul. His verses resonate with readers on a profound level, leaving them with an awe-inspiring representation of the West, its people, and their stories.
The Themes Explored
Within "Even Further West," Shaffer tackles a myriad of themes that delve into the human condition, the vastness of life, and the intricacies of existence. Through his exploration of love, loss, memory, and nature's enduring spirit, he navigates the emotional spectrum with grace and sensitivity.
One of the noteworthy themes in Shaffer's poetry is the exploration of time and its impact on our perception of place. He dives into both the historical and the contemporary, bridging the gap between the past and the present through poignant narratives that intertwine decades, centuries, and millennia. As we read, we become travelers not only across space but also across time, witnessing the unfolding of tales told by those long gone and feeling the echoes of their voices in the present day.

One evening on Lāhaina’s Front Street, as Shaffer walked to an evening with friends, someone passing on the sidewalk commented, “The islands are even further west than I thought.” Those accidental words, like poetry, shifted his perspective once again regarding the place he lives. Even Further West is a collection of poems written of, in, and on the Hawaiian islands. Companion volume to Lāhaina Noon, this collection includes poems striving to encounter and reveal the actual place and people hidden behind the pictures and posters, the myths and misunderstandings, of America’s only tropical state.
Years ago assigned by a keen reviewer to the “Clear Pool School” of poetry, Shaffer’s work again presents sharply detailed and unexpected scenes of how the blue world looks as a bouncing inflatable globe on a day at the beach, beneath a single streetlight on a dark upcountry road, after the surprise of “NO TRESPASSING” signs between slippahs and the sand, beyond our perverse thirst for apocalypse even in paradise. Yet a love for the land, people, friends, and significant others on the islands shines within these pages as well, in dry grass or rain, under plumeria and kiawe, and leads to lives that grow and flourish in the same landscape.
